Output 61fd24f82cbfe06c5196fd38b8783b5e7b4314bd4ced95ae11b9e26c50d0a958:21

value
8769
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8e95f243a7c704f58885f97d349a23cbf374eb30b32cddbdda5c56f97c5eb3e
address
bc1pmr547fp603cy7kygt7taxjdz8jlnwn4npvevmk7a5hzkl979avlqz760tl
transaction
61fd24f82cbfe06c5196fd38b8783b5e7b4314bd4ced95ae11b9e26c50d0a958
spent
true